CLK350 4Matic completely dead.

I have a 2009 CLK350 4Matic and this morning I went to get into my car and the keyless entry wouldn't work. I thought maybe the battery in that was dead so I used the mechanical key and opened the door, but the anti theft system didn't make a sound. I then put the key in the ignition and tried to turn the engine over, but there was no response aswell as no response when turning on any interior lights or hazard lights. Everything is completely dead. I am going to charge the battery tomorrow morning to see if its that, but the car was only sitting overnight in -5 degree whether. I had just recently driven the car 650km in snowy weather aswell as recently had my engine shampooed a week ago. But there had been no issues prior. Does anybody have any input? Not really pleased if I am going to have to tow my car into a shop.

Checking the battery would be my first assumption. My battery died a week and I didn't need to use my mechanical key to enter. My lights and everything still works but this was in 70 degree weather and the battery still had some juice even though it wasn't enough to turn over. If this is a battery issue, I'd invest in a battery maintainer because of how cold it gets where you're located.
